Srinagar, June 25: As many as 4681 people were fined Rs 6.57 lakh for violating COVID-19 guidelines during the last 24 hours in Kashmir valley.
A police spokesperson said that continuing its efforts to curb the outbreak of second wave of Coronavirus, police arrested a person, lodged two FIRs and also realized fine to the tune of Rs 6,57,540 from 4681 people during the last 24 hours in the valley for violating various COVID-19 guidelines.
He said the special drive against the violators of COVID-19 guidelines continued in all the districts of Kashmir Valley to ensure that people adhere to SOPs envisaged by government to curb COVID-19 pandemic.
